If you frequent parties and events in the Lowcountry, chances are you’ve had a taste of Cru Catering (four-cheese macaroni ring any bells?). From fancy fundraisers to weddings to South of Broad soirees, locals have learned they can count on Cru for solid catering. But to really enjoy their offerings, head to Cru Café, just off of the Market. The restaurant is located in a cozy historic home on Pinckney Street, with tables spread out on the front porch and the two rooms inside. As you walk up the porch steps and in the front door, it feels intimate yet welcoming, like you’re dining at a friend’s house. Chef John Zucker puts a gourmet twist on comfort food with offerings like buttermilk fried oyster salad with apple-smoked bacon and honey sherry dressing, chicken paillard, and Thai seafood risotto with coconut milk, soy, sriracha, and carnaroli rice. Go for lunch if you’re on a budget — salads and sandwiches are priced around $10. —Erica Jackson Curran
